What features should I look for in a large print, pocket-sized Tehillim?
Beyond font size and portability, consider these additional features:
- Type of paper: Thinner paper will make the book lighter, ideal for portability, but thicker paper might feel more durable.
- Binding: A durable binding is essential to withstand frequent use. Consider a sewn binding for longevity.
- Translations and Commentaries: Some editions include translations or commentaries, adding depth to your prayer experience. Consider whether this is a desired feature.
- Additional Features: Some editions may include features like ribbon bookmarks, gilded edges, or other embellishments. These are aesthetic considerations that add to the overall experience.
Are there different translations available in large print pocket Tehillim?
Yes, different translations of the Psalms are available in various large print, pocket-sized editions. Common translations include the Artscroll, Koren, and others. Choose the translation that best suits your understanding and preference. Consider if you need a Hebrew-English edition or just one language.
What is the ideal font size for a large print Tehillim?
The ideal font size is subjective and depends on individual needs. However, a font size of at least 14 points is generally considered large print, and many editions offer even larger sizes. Check the product specifications before purchasing to ensure it meets your visual needs.
